1 HOST-RESOURCES-TYPES DEFINITIONS ::= BEGIN
4 MODULE-IDENTITY, OBJECT-IDENTITY FROM SNMPv2-SMI
5 hrMIBAdminInfo, hrStorage, hrDevice FROM HOST-RESOURCES-MIB;
7 hostResourcesTypesModule MODULE-IDENTITY
8 LAST-UPDATED "200003060000Z" -- 6 March, 2000
9 ORGANIZATION "IETF Host Resources MIB Working Group"
12 Postal: Lucent Technologies, Inc.
18 Email: waldbusser@ins.com
20 In addition, the Host Resources MIB mailing list is dedicated
21 to discussion of this MIB. To join the mailing list, send a
22 request message to hostmib-request@andrew.cmu.edu. The mailing
23 list address is hostmib@andrew.cmu.edu."
25 "This MIB module registers type definitions for
26 storage types, device types, and file system types.
27 After the initial revision, this module will be
29 REVISION "200003060000Z" -- 6 March 2000
31 "The original version of this module, published as RFC
33 ::= { hrMIBAdminInfo 4 }
35 -- Registrations for some storage types, for use with hrStorageType
36 hrStorageTypes OBJECT IDENTIFIER ::= { hrStorage 1 }
38 hrStorageOther OBJECT-IDENTITY
41 "The storage type identifier used when no other defined
43 ::= { hrStorageTypes 1 }
45 hrStorageRam OBJECT-IDENTITY
48 "The storage type identifier used for RAM."
49 ::= { hrStorageTypes 2 }
51 hrStorageVirtualMemory OBJECT-IDENTITY
54 "The storage type identifier used for virtual memory,
55 temporary storage of swapped or paged memory."
56 ::= { hrStorageTypes 3 }
58 hrStorageFixedDisk OBJECT-IDENTITY
61 "The storage type identifier used for non-removable
62 rigid rotating magnetic storage devices."
63 ::= { hrStorageTypes 4 }
65 hrStorageRemovableDisk OBJECT-IDENTITY
68 "The storage type identifier used for removable rigid
69 rotating magnetic storage devices."
70 ::= { hrStorageTypes 5 }
72 hrStorageFloppyDisk OBJECT-IDENTITY
75 "The storage type identifier used for non-rigid rotating
76 magnetic storage devices."
77 ::= { hrStorageTypes 6 }
79 hrStorageCompactDisc OBJECT-IDENTITY
82 "The storage type identifier used for read-only rotating
83 optical storage devices."
84 ::= { hrStorageTypes 7 }
86 hrStorageRamDisk OBJECT-IDENTITY
89 "The storage type identifier used for a file system that
91 ::= { hrStorageTypes 8 }
93 hrStorageFlashMemory OBJECT-IDENTITY
96 "The storage type identifier used for flash memory."
97 ::= { hrStorageTypes 9 }
99 hrStorageNetworkDisk OBJECT-IDENTITY
102 "The storage type identifier used for a
103 networked file system."
104 ::= { hrStorageTypes 10 }
106 -- Registrations for some device types, for use with hrDeviceType
107 hrDeviceTypes OBJECT IDENTIFIER ::= { hrDevice 1 }
109 hrDeviceOther OBJECT-IDENTITY
112 "The device type identifier used when no other defined
113 type is appropriate."
114 ::= { hrDeviceTypes 1 }
116 hrDeviceUnknown OBJECT-IDENTITY
119 "The device type identifier used when the device type is
121 ::= { hrDeviceTypes 2 }
123 hrDeviceProcessor OBJECT-IDENTITY
126 "The device type identifier used for a CPU."
127 ::= { hrDeviceTypes 3 }
129 hrDeviceNetwork OBJECT-IDENTITY
132 "The device type identifier used for a network interface."
133 ::= { hrDeviceTypes 4 }
135 hrDevicePrinter OBJECT-IDENTITY
138 "The device type identifier used for a printer."
139 ::= { hrDeviceTypes 5 }
141 hrDeviceDiskStorage OBJECT-IDENTITY
144 "The device type identifier used for a disk drive."
145 ::= { hrDeviceTypes 6 }
147 hrDeviceVideo OBJECT-IDENTITY
150 "The device type identifier used for a video device."
151 ::= { hrDeviceTypes 10 }
153 hrDeviceAudio OBJECT-IDENTITY
156 "The device type identifier used for an audio device."
157 ::= { hrDeviceTypes 11 }
159 hrDeviceCoprocessor OBJECT-IDENTITY
162 "The device type identifier used for a co-processor."
163 ::= { hrDeviceTypes 12 }
165 hrDeviceKeyboard OBJECT-IDENTITY
168 "The device type identifier used for a keyboard device."
169 ::= { hrDeviceTypes 13 }
171 hrDeviceModem OBJECT-IDENTITY
174 "The device type identifier used for a modem."
175 ::= { hrDeviceTypes 14 }
177 hrDeviceParallelPort OBJECT-IDENTITY
180 "The device type identifier used for a parallel port."
181 ::= { hrDeviceTypes 15 }
183 hrDevicePointing OBJECT-IDENTITY
186 "The device type identifier used for a pointing device
188 ::= { hrDeviceTypes 16 }
190 hrDeviceSerialPort OBJECT-IDENTITY
193 "The device type identifier used for a serial port."
194 ::= { hrDeviceTypes 17 }
196 hrDeviceTape OBJECT-IDENTITY
199 "The device type identifier used for a tape storage device."
200 ::= { hrDeviceTypes 18 }
202 hrDeviceClock OBJECT-IDENTITY
205 "The device type identifier used for a clock device."
206 ::= { hrDeviceTypes 19 }
208 hrDeviceVolatileMemory OBJECT-IDENTITY
211 "The device type identifier used for a volatile memory
213 ::= { hrDeviceTypes 20 }
215 hrDeviceNonVolatileMemory OBJECT-IDENTITY
218 "The device type identifier used for a non-volatile memory
220 ::= { hrDeviceTypes 21 }
222 -- Registrations for some popular File System types,
223 -- for use with hrFSType.
224 hrFSTypes OBJECT IDENTIFIER ::= { hrDevice 9 }
226 hrFSOther OBJECT-IDENTITY
229 "The file system type identifier used when no other
230 defined type is appropriate."
233 hrFSUnknown OBJECT-IDENTITY
236 "The file system type identifier used when the type of
237 file system is unknown."
240 hrFSBerkeleyFFS OBJECT-IDENTITY
243 "The file system type identifier used for the
244 Berkeley Fast File System."
247 hrFSSys5FS OBJECT-IDENTITY
250 "The file system type identifier used for the
251 System V File System."
254 hrFSFat OBJECT-IDENTITY
257 "The file system type identifier used for
258 DOS's FAT file system."
261 hrFSHPFS OBJECT-IDENTITY
264 "The file system type identifier used for OS/2's
265 High Performance File System."
268 hrFSHFS OBJECT-IDENTITY
271 "The file system type identifier used for the
272 Macintosh Hierarchical File System."
275 hrFSMFS OBJECT-IDENTITY
278 "The file system type identifier used for the
279 Macintosh File System."
282 hrFSNTFS OBJECT-IDENTITY
285 "The file system type identifier used for the
286 Windows NT File System."
289 hrFSVNode OBJECT-IDENTITY
292 "The file system type identifier used for the
296 hrFSJournaled OBJECT-IDENTITY
299 "The file system type identifier used for the
300 Journaled File System."
303 hrFSiso9660 OBJECT-IDENTITY
306 "The file system type identifier used for the
307 ISO 9660 File System for CD's."
310 hrFSRockRidge OBJECT-IDENTITY
313 "The file system type identifier used for the
314 RockRidge File System for CD's."
317 hrFSNFS OBJECT-IDENTITY
320 "The file system type identifier used for the
324 hrFSNetware OBJECT-IDENTITY
327 "The file system type identifier used for the
328 Netware File System."
331 hrFSAFS OBJECT-IDENTITY
334 "The file system type identifier used for the
338 hrFSDFS OBJECT-IDENTITY
341 "The file system type identifier used for the
342 OSF DCE Distributed File System."
345 hrFSAppleshare OBJECT-IDENTITY
348 "The file system type identifier used for the
349 AppleShare File System."
352 hrFSRFS OBJECT-IDENTITY
355 "The file system type identifier used for the
359 hrFSDGCFS OBJECT-IDENTITY
362 "The file system type identifier used for the
366 hrFSBFS OBJECT-IDENTITY
369 "The file system type identifier used for the
370 SVR4 Boot File System."
373 hrFSFAT32 OBJECT-IDENTITY
376 "The file system type identifier used for the
377 Windows FAT32 File System."
380 hrFSLinuxExt2 OBJECT-IDENTITY
383 "The file system type identifier used for the
384 Linux EXT2 File System."